Assistant Bookkeeper
Job Description
Job Description
We are seeking an Assistant Bookkeeper to join our team. The successful candidate will be responsible for processing invoices related to the company's income and expenses. This role is also responsible for maintaining accurate records of the accounting transactions and resolving discrepancies as they arise. The ideal candidate will have strong attention to detail, excellent organizational skills, and the ability to work independently. This position reports to the Bookkeeping Manager and can work with other members of the accounting team to ensure accurate and timely financial reporting.
Minimum Qualifications:
- 5+ years of experience in an accounting role
- Experience in Accounts Payable and Accounts Receivable
- Understanding of Accounting Principles and double-entry accounting, and general ledgers
- Accounting software experience, preferably QuickBooks, is required
- Attention to detail, strong problem-solving skill,s and organizational skills
- Self-starter with the ability to work efficiently in a fast-paced environment
- Strong problem-solving skills
- Experience working with multiple companies on a daily basis is a plus
Responsibilities:
- Receive and process vendor invoices
- Create customer invoices and receive payments
- Maintain accurate records of all transactions
- Experience in researching and resolving any discrepancies that may arise
- Experience reconciling multiple credit cards each month
- Ability to set up and maintain vendor files and process year-end tax documents
Software:
- QuickBooks Desktop and Online
- Excel – Ability to create spreadsheets
- Bill and Tallie experience would be an added advantage
- 10-Key Calculator
Recommended Jobs
Registered Nurse, Emergency Services, 11A -11P
What makes Vaughn Regional Medical Center a wonderful place to work? Our people, of course! Our Registered Nurses answer this special call because they have a fundamental, internal drive…
Payroll Manager
Overview: Diversified Gas & Oil Corporation (“DGOC”) is a wholly-owned subsidiary of Diversified Energy Company PLC, a US-based company listed on the New York Stock Exchange (NYSE) and London Stock E…
Furnace Operator
Job Description Job Description Join the Kelly® Professional & Industrial team as a Furnace Operator at an elite tooling company in Huntsville, AL. Please send your resume to marb621@kellyser…
Breakfast Host
Mansa Hospitality in Fultondale, AL is looking for one breakfast host to join our 22 person strong team. We are located on 1701 Main Street. Our ideal candidate is a self-starter, ambitious, and enga…
CV Surgery NP or PA needed in Dothan, AL
About the Position: Group is seeking a skilled Cardiovascular Surgery Advanced Practice Provider (NP or PA) to join a well-established, hospital-employed surgical group. This is an excellent opportu…
Copy Center Associate
Job Description Job Description Law Firm in Downtown Birmingham has an immediate opening for a Copy Center Associate. Experience preferred but not required. Must be organized, detail oriented, ab…
Low Voltage Technician
Low Voltage Technician Location: Huntsville, AL (On-Site) Division: Low Voltage Company: State Systems, Inc. About State Systems, Inc. Founded in Memphis, TN, State Systems, Inc. is …
Club Manager
Job Summary The Club Manager will be responsible for the oversight of gym operations to ensure an exceptional “Judgement Free” member experience as well as a financially successful club. The Clu…
Recruiter/Talent Sourcer (Civil & Environmental Engineering)
Job Description Job Description Ardurra is seeking a Recruiter/Talent Sourcer ideally based in our market geography, with the flexibility to work remotely! We are an exciting and growing engi…
Junior Software Developer
Junior Software Developer - Job Description Job description We seek a motivated Junior Software Developer to join and work closely with our development team. This role is ideal for someone…